Substrate, oh the choices.
Ive been using Ecoearth coconut substrate since I got my snakes but the stuff is expensive, and although its supposedly ok for them to ingest some.. it still worries me. Sometimes they get a mouthfull of the stuff and it takes them awhile to work it out because its so fine. However its more natural looking and holds humidity/heat very well.
Im thinking of switching to pine shreddings because they are cheaper and also safe from my understanding. My concern with them is heat transferal. I use an aquarium style habitat so my UTH plays a vital role in keeping there tanks warm, and I cant imagine that wood chips transfer heat very well. There is also the moisture factor in an aquarium, I cant imagine wood chips holding moisture well without molding

Mostly newspaper, it's cheap and easy just like.. oh wait! lol When soiled, just crumple it all up, toss and replace. I just started using aspen for my corn snake since she likes to burrow and I sometimes use ecoearth for my ATBs, sometimes just newspaper.
Botis, if you swtich to a shreddings, please use Aspen instead of Pine, it's safer for the animals IMO.
